MindLabs operates a live digital platform for mental health and preventative wellness. The application offers daily video sessions and on-demand classes led by qualified experts.
MindLabs has secured £1.4m in pre-seed funding led by Passion Capital. The round included participation from Seedcamp and several prominent technology entrepreneurs including the founders of Cazoo, Zoopla, Urban and Carwow. The capital will be deployed to expand the company engineering, video production and content teams as it prepares to launch its mobile application.
The London-based business was established by media entrepreneurs Adnan Ebrahim and Gabor Szedlak, who previously built and exited Car Throttle. Their new venture arrives amidst heightened demand for mental health support driven by the coronavirus pandemic.
